Tommy writes:
Small correction for your blog entry http://stlcofcc.wordpress.com/2008/02/07/shooting-at-kirkwood-city-hall/
“And this is probably how he was able to fire 15 rounds inside the meeting room, because law enforcement is allowed to have pistol clips that fire 15 shots, unlike non-felonious civilians, who have a 10-limit thanks to the 1994 Crime Bill.”
Modern pistols do not use “clips”. They use magazines.
http://www.thegunzone.com/clips-mags.html
The 1994 Crime Bill sunsetted in 2004. Civilians can now legally purchase magazines of a capacity greater than 10 round.
Sorry, Tommy. This was, as George Wallace called it, a fox paw. Also, the 1994 Crime Bill, for the decade that its gun restrictions were in effect, did not prohibit the possession or ownership of 15-round magazines, they merely prohibited the sale of magazines that hold more than 10 rounds to civilians. There was, for that decade, a seller’s market on pre-1994 15-round magazines.
